Basic info on Infiniti Q60 Cabrio 37 (320hp)

The Japanese car was first shown in year 2008 and powered by a 6 - cylinder nat. asp. petrol unit, produced by Nissan. The engine offers a displacement of 3.7 litre matched to a rear wheel drive system and a manual gearbox with 6 or a automatic gearbox with 7 gears. Vehicle in question is a sports car with the top speed of 250km/h, reaching the 100km/h (62mph) mark in 6.2s and consuming around 11.9 liters of fuel every 100 kilometers.
